Breaking Through the Local Scene
Breaking into the local music scene is both exciting and tough for drummers who aim high. It's a big first step towards a strong drumming career. To make it, drummers need to show off what makes them special and choose their own way in music.
Being devoted is key to making waves locally. Drummers should spend many hours improving their skills and trying new things on their drums. This focus helps them stand out, raising the level of their shows.
Connecting with the local music world is vital. By meeting other musicians and music pros, drummers can get advice, learn, and find new chances. These contacts might lead to exciting gigs and more people knowing them.
Using social media to connect with fans is a game changer. Drummers can build a fan base, create buzz, and catch the eye of music professionals online. Sharing their music journey and daily life can make fans feel closer to them.
Success locally needs more than talent and practice. Drummers must figure out what makes their sound special. Showing their unique style helps them shine in the local music scene.
